Gimli and Legolas were definitely altered the most from their characters in the book. hardy Gimli, backbone of the Fellowship, was reduced to C-3P0 level humor (the dwarf tossing jokes, come on, seriously embarrassing to watch) and Legolas was turned into the male equivalent of Liv Tyler's presence in the movies (ostensibly eye candy).

some of the characters were done really well though IMO (Boromir, Saruman, Gandalf, Ian Holm Bilbo). I actually really like 50% of the LOTR movies (Fellowship is honestly solid to me, idgaf) so I can't hate Jackson too much. Although some of what he did, especially with the Hobbit movies is just a fucking shame, there are a lot of cool aspects of his interpretations as well.

seeing Alan Lee's paintings come to life, especially in FOTR when everything was still organic and real looking and not totally CGI is STILL awesome to watch.
